Types of Student Accommodation in Plymouth
On-Campus Residences
Many universities in Plymouth offer on-campus housing, providing students with the convenience of being close to academic facilities. These residences often include:
- Furnished rooms with essential amenities.
- Access to common areas, such as study rooms and lounges.
- Proximity to libraries and student centers.

Private Student Accommodation
Private student accommodations are a popular choice for those seeking a bit more independence. These options usually offer:
- En-suite rooms or studio apartments.
- Shared kitchen and living areas.
- Facilities such as gyms, laundry rooms, and social spaces.

Shared Housing and Flats
For students who prefer a more homely environment, shared houses or flats can be an ideal option. These typically include:
- Shared living spaces with a small group of students.
- Opportunities for communal living and shared responsibilities.
- Often more affordable than other housing types.

Tips for Choosing the Right Student Accommodation
Consider the Location
It is vital to select a location that aligns with your lifestyle and accessibility needs. Consider factors such as:
- Proximity to the university and public transport.
- Nearby amenities, including shops and healthcare facilities.
- The safety and security of the neighborhood.

Inspect the Accommodation
Before finalizing any decision, it’s crucial to inspect the accommodation. Look for:
- The condition of the facilities and furnishings.
- Any signs of wear or needed repairs.
- The functionality of essential services such as heating and plumbing.
